## Billing worker: blue-green cutover

1. Scale green Ledgerette workers to match blue.
2. Drain blue queue; confirm zero in-flight invoices.
3. Flip the Tollgate router flag.
4. Watch error rate for 10 minutes; revert flag on any spike.
5. Decommission blue after one clean billing cycle.

Record the deploy by pasting the trace token just below this line.

session token of baguf-bageg = htk3_538

Subject: Ownership change — nightly search reindex

As of next sprint, responsibility for the Querystone nightly reindex job is moving off my plate. The job rebuilds the catalogue index at 02:30 and backfills deltas from the Larchbrook event stream. Review requests, failure alerts, and schedule changes should now be routed to the new owner.

named custodian: Brivan Eliath Quenox Frador

## Step 4 — Deploy the thumbnail queue

This step promotes the Snapforge thumbnail generation queue to production. Drain the staging workers first (`snapctl drain --pool thumbs`), confirm the backlog is under 200 jobs, then apply the new worker image. Resizing profiles are loaded at boot, so a rolling restart is required — do not hot-swap configs. The queue broker authenticates deploy pushes per-release, so each rollout needs its own credential. Use the deploy key below.

deploy key for kajof-fajop: bky6_gDHw9Q

Ticket: Fernpath Survey offline mode stores unsynced responses in plaintext on device. Includes respondent GPS coordinates. Needs encryption-at-rest review before the pilot in the Dunmore valley region. Sync queue also retains records after upload; confirm retention policy. Repro steps attached to the ticket. Affected build noted below.

session token of tajef-bageg = htk21_5d90d574934f3ccae6437

## Artifact Signing — Fabrikit Test-Data Factory

All Fabrikit releases must be signed before publishing to the internal registry. The signing step runs in the Lintwood pipeline after unit tests pass; unsigned artifacts are rejected by the registry gate. Per last week's sync, builds should use the current release key, shown below.

deploy key for yajop-fahop: bky3_h1v